日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区

您的位置:首頁技術文章
文章詳情頁

讓Vue響應Map或Set的變化操作

瀏覽:21日期:2022-10-31 18:21:45

問題背景

我想在vuex的state中使用map,這樣可以使很多操作變得方便

const state = { all: new Map()}

這樣的寫法是沒有問題的,不會報錯,state.all可以像正常的Map一樣使用。

但是這里有一個問題,vue的響應式系統不支持Map和Set,也就是說,當Map與Set里面的元素變化時Vue追蹤不到這些變化,因此無法做出響應。這樣一來,頁面上依賴all的元素也不會隨all的變化而變化

解決方法

用戶”inca”的回答

you need to create a serializable replica of this structure and expose it to Vue

data() { mySetChangeTracker: 1, mySet: new Set(),},computed: { mySetAsList() { var x = this.mySetChangeTracker; // By using `mySetChangeTracker` we tell Vue that this property depends on it, // so it gets re-evaluated whenever `mySetChangeTracker` changes return Array.from(this.mySet); },},methods: { add(item) { this.mySet.add(item); // Trigger Vue updates this.mySetChangeTracker += 1; }}

解決方法是用一個可序列化的mySetChangeTracker來手動追蹤變化

Vue追蹤不到Set的變化,但是可以追蹤到mySetChangeTracker的變化,所以當Set發生改變后,手動改變mySetChangeTracker的值就能讓Vue知道我的數據發生了變化。

在mySetAsList里面寫入var x = this.mySetChangeTracker,這樣一來當mySetChangeTracker更新后,mySetAsList就會做出響應

補充知識:vue渲染時對象里面的對象的屬性提示undefined,但渲染成功

場景:

從后臺請求的數據結構如下:

讓Vue響應Map或Set的變化操作

讓Vue響應Map或Set的變化操作

我的list是對象,而comment又是list里的對象,渲染成功了,卻報如下錯:

讓Vue響應Map或Set的變化操作

解決辦法:

添加一個:v-if

讓Vue響應Map或Set的變化操作

以上這篇讓Vue響應Map或Set的變化操作就是小編分享給大家的全部內容了,希望能給大家一個參考,也希望大家多多支持好吧啦網。

標簽: Vue
相關文章:
日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区
蜜桃tv一区二区三区| 久久男人天堂| 蜜臀av性久久久久蜜臀aⅴ四虎| 在线看片不卡| 日本欧美韩国一区三区| 久久高清精品| 麻豆精品99| 亚洲欧洲日韩精品在线| 麻豆视频在线观看免费网站黄| 亚洲性图久久| 国产一区二区精品福利地址| 视频精品一区二区| 久久久久久美女精品| 国际精品欧美精品| 亚洲一区二区小说| 好吊视频一区二区三区四区| 黄色在线观看www| 国产精品av一区二区| 欧美91在线|欧美| 日本久久一区| 欧美www视频在线观看| 日韩三级视频| 免费在线观看日韩欧美| 国产精品毛片| 欧美资源在线| 亚洲影视一区| 久久激情五月婷婷| 国产精品扒开腿做爽爽爽软件| 日本一区免费网站| 国产精品主播在线观看| 国产丝袜一区| 精品视频自拍| 少妇精品导航| 青青久久av| 日韩亚洲一区在线| 日本韩国欧美超级黄在线观看| 国产麻豆久久| 中文欧美日韩| 国产剧情在线观看一区| 精品不卡一区| 久久精品高清| 亚洲精品自拍| 国产第一亚洲| 99国产精品久久久久久久| 免费人成在线不卡| 久久爱www.| 久久精品国产亚洲夜色av网站| 免费观看不卡av| 日韩一区二区三区高清在线观看| 91精品国产一区二区在线观看| 麻豆一区二区三| 免费在线看一区| 国际精品欧美精品| 亚洲日韩中文字幕一区| 国内在线观看一区二区三区| 激情欧美一区二区三区| 国产乱人伦精品一区| 国产99精品| 国产精品扒开腿做爽爽爽软件| 亚洲午夜黄色| 国产中文欧美日韩在线| 综合激情网...| 99久久精品费精品国产| 蜜桃av一区二区| 91精品国产91久久久久久黑人| 欧美日韩亚洲一区三区| 亚洲激情av| 丝袜av一区| 久久电影tv| 国产精品久久久久久久久久10秀| 婷婷五月色综合香五月| 欧美 日韩 国产精品免费观看| 老司机免费视频一区二区三区| 中文字幕一区二区三区四区久久| 久久九九精品| 婷婷激情一区| 欧美日韩国产观看视频| 国产一区二区三区四区五区传媒| 亚洲精品美女91| 亚洲色诱最新| 在线视频亚洲| 免费视频最近日韩| 日韩在线播放一区二区| 亚洲一区二区免费看| 欧美另类专区| 亚洲制服少妇| 亚洲v天堂v手机在线| 欧美久久亚洲| 精品网站999| 黄色在线网站噜噜噜| 久久久久久免费视频| 午夜国产精品视频免费体验区| 亚洲精品国产偷自在线观看| 日韩欧美精品| 国产一区日韩一区| 中文字幕视频精品一区二区三区| 视频精品一区| 国产精品久久久久77777丨| 国产精品免费大片| 国产精品www.| 久久99青青| 亚洲婷婷在线| 综合色一区二区| 精品亚洲成人| 亚洲黄色影院| 久久狠狠亚洲综合| 神马日本精品| 日韩欧美中文字幕在线视频| 麻豆精品新av中文字幕| zzzwww在线看片免费| 视频精品一区二区| 国产成人精品一区二区三区免费 | 日韩专区视频网站| 国产精品久久久久久久免费软件| av中文资源在线资源免费观看| 天堂中文av在线资源库| 亚洲女人av| 国产一区二区三区探花| 日韩精品一级二级 | 国产精品视频一区二区三区 | 五月激情久久| 91亚洲精品在看在线观看高清| 精品成av人一区二区三区| 日韩中文字幕不卡| 欧美搞黄网站| 久久国产毛片| 婷婷激情一区| 久久久水蜜桃av免费网站| 国产精品观看| 欧美日韩一视频区二区| 蜜桃视频免费观看一区| 国产一级一区二区| 日韩av在线播放网址| 国产精品一页| 欧美久久香蕉| 国产毛片久久久| 欧美日韩亚洲一区| 国产精品亚洲产品| 欧美一级二级视频| 日韩av影院| 国产欧美日韩免费观看| 日本vs亚洲vs韩国一区三区二区| 午夜在线精品| 亚洲一级淫片| 国产情侣久久| 久久精品国产在热久久| 久久亚洲国产精品尤物| 日本va欧美va瓶| 日韩精品一区二区三区中文在线 | 中文日韩欧美| 婷婷精品在线| 久久国际精品| 黄色aa久久| 久久国产福利| 欧美国产另类| 亚洲先锋成人| 欧美在线看片| 精品资源在线| 亚洲精品国产偷自在线观看| 一区二区三区国产在线| 国产精品蜜月aⅴ在线| 日韩av片子| 国产精品日本| 久久精品1区| 日韩精彩视频在线观看| 久久精品国产99国产| 免费av一区| 国产精品日本一区二区不卡视频 | 国产一区二区三区免费在线| 99久久久久国产精品| 首页欧美精品中文字幕| 国产精品4hu.www| 自拍日韩欧美| 精品视频一区二区三区在线观看 | 国产精品91一区二区三区| 日韩精品一区二区三区中文| 欧美好骚综合网| 中文字幕日本一区二区| 日韩欧美午夜| 国产精品一区二区三区四区在线观看| 日本精品影院| 成人污污视频| 国产乱码精品一区二区亚洲| 久久亚洲视频| 午夜久久免费观看| zzzwww在线看片免费| 欧美精品二区| 国产欧美日韩精品一区二区三区| 黄色免费成人| 视频福利一区| 亚洲成人一区在线观看| 国产精品网址| 国产视频一区二| 欧美精品观看| 老鸭窝一区二区久久精品| 日韩av成人高清| 国产日韩一区二区三区在线播放| 日日夜夜免费精品视频| 日韩毛片网站| 国产欧美91|